#be7698 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#be7698 is composed of 74.5% red, 46.3%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 37.9% magenta, 20% yellow and 25.5% black. It has a hue angle of 331.7 degrees, a saturation of 35.6% and a lightness of 60.4%. #be7698 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ffecff with #7d0031. Closest websafe color is: #cc6699.

Shades and Tints of #be7698

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#090407 is the darkest color, while #fdfbfc is the lightest one.

Tones of #be7698

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#9f959a is the less saturated color, while #fc3895 is the most saturated one.
